az firmwareanalysis workspace
Note
This reference is part of the firmwareanalysis extension for the Azure CLI (version 2.55.0 or higher). The extension will automatically install the first time you run an az firmwareanalysis workspace command. Learn more about extensions.
Commands to perform operation on a particular workspace of the firmware.

az firmwareanalysis workspace create
Create or update a firmware analysis workspace.
az firmwareanalysis workspace create --name --workspace-name
--resource-group
[--___location]
[--tags]
Examples
create or update a firmware analysis workspace.
az firmwareanalysis workspace create --resource-group {resourceGroupName} --workspace-name {workspaceName} --___location {___location} --tags {<string>:<string>, <string>:<string>,..}
Required Parameters
The name of the firmware analysis workspace.
Name of resource group. You can configure the default group using az configure --defaults group=<name>
.
Optional Parameters
The following parameters are optional, but depending on the context, one or more might become required for the command to execute successfully.
The geo-___location where the resource lives When not specified, the ___location of the resource group will be used.

az firmwareanalysis workspace list
List all of the firmware analysis workspaces in the specified subscription.
az firmwareanalysis workspace list [--max-items]
[--next-token]
[--resource-group]
Examples
List all of the firmware analysis workspaces in the specified subscription.
az firmwareanalysis workspace list --resource-group {ResourceGroupName}
Optional Parameters
The following parameters are optional, but depending on the context, one or more might become required for the command to execute successfully.
Total number of items to return in the command's output. If the total number of items available is more than the value specified, a token is provided in the command's output. To resume pagination, provide the token value in --next-token
argument of a subsequent command.
Property | Value |
---|---|
Parameter group: | Pagination Arguments |
Token to specify where to start paginating. This is the token value from a previously truncated response.
Property | Value |
---|---|
Parameter group: | Pagination Arguments |
Name of resource group. You can configure the default group using az configure --defaults group=<name>
.
